Houston we have a problem!!
According to Fox26 Houston and Houston Health Department (HHD), Houston and Harris County are experiencing a syphilis outbreak after Houston Health Department (HHD) reports a 128% increase in cases among women and a nine-fold rise in congenital syphilis.
Let’s talk about it……….What is Syphilis?
Syphilis is s*xually transmitted infection (STI) that can cause serious health problems without treatment. Infection develops in stages (primary, secondary, latent, and tertiary). Each stage can have different signs and symptoms. New syphilis infections are known as primary, secondary and early latent syphilis.Syphilis can easily be treated with antibiotics but without adequate treatment, the infection progresses to the secondary stage when one or more areas of the skin break into a rash – usually non-itchy and most typically on the palms and soles. You can get syphilis by direct contact with a syphilis sore during vaginal, a**l, or oral s*x. Condoms prevent the spread of syphilis by preventing contact with a sore. However, sometimes sores occur in areas not covered by a condom. Contact with these sores can still transmit syphilis.
Anyone who is s*xually active is at risk of contracting syphilis. If you have been recently diagnosed with any other STI, such as gonorrhea or chlamydia or HIV you at an increased risk of contracting syphilis
Why the focus on women?
If you are pregnant and have syphilis, you can give the infection to your unborn baby. Babies born with syphilis who go untreated can develop sever health problems that could ultimately end in death.
